Transaction 62142d781802e37911b483f9e054f70fe475e6a6f96ca9527b7370ded965bd4b

1 Input
2 Outputs
  • 62142d781802e37911b483f9e054f70fe475e6a6f96ca9527b7370ded965bd4b:0
  • value  3272093
    address  3DuonE8LNRT6D1vTn7rFVK5eAqXW7iTBer
  • 62142d781802e37911b483f9e054f70fe475e6a6f96ca9527b7370ded965bd4b:1
  • value  483741753
    address  33QvT5rpZ3N8udwbxZgaK9SC35re8K4kJC